RFC defines that the aging time is 24 hours. However, ZXR10 6900
is required to configure this aging time. Considering the actual
requirement we make this modification and this makes the aging
time of nd stale state be configured.
This example describes how to configure the aging time is 20
hours.
ZXR10(config)#ipv6 nd stale-time 1200

qos conform-local
Use this command to set the mapping table for allocating the
802.1P user priority parameters with conformance level and lo-
cal-precedence as indexes.
Global configuration
qos conform-local <conform-level><cos0-value><cos1-value
><cos2-value><cos3-value><cos4-value><cos5-value><cos6-
value><cos7-value>
no qos conform-local <conform-level>
